How WhatsApp is changing hotel guest engagement

WhatsApp has quietly become the most powerful communication tool in hospitality, with over 2 billion users worldwide and more than 175 million people messaging businesses daily on the platform. At the most recent Meta Conversations event in 2025, Meta shared that more than 100 million people in the US have used WhatsApp. For hotels, this represents an unprecedented opportunity to connect with guests where they already spend their time.

More and more travelers prefer to use messaging channels like WhatsApp over phone calls when engaging with hotels. Yet many hotels are still treating WhatsApp like a simple messaging app instead of using its full potential through AI automation.

Why WhatsApp dominates hotel guest communication

WhatsApp's dominance in hospitality comes down to convenience and global reach. Unlike email or phone calls, WhatsApp allows guests to communicate with hotels using the same app they use to chat with friends and family. This familiarity removes friction from the booking process and creates a more natural conversation flow.

International travelers particularly favor WhatsApp because it works seamlessly across countries without additional charges. A guest planning a trip to Mexico can message hotels directly from their home country, receive instant responses, and even complete their booking without switching apps or platforms.

The platform's multimedia capabilities also make it ideal for hospitality. Hotels can instantly share room photos, location maps, dining menus, and even process payments through WhatsApp Business API, creating a comprehensive booking experience within a single conversation thread.

The response time challenge most hotels face

Traditional hotel communication methods create bottlenecks that cost bookings. Phone calls go unanswered during busy periods, emails sit in inboxes for hours, and website contact forms disappear into the void. Meanwhile, potential guests are making split-second decisions about where to stay.

Most hotel staff juggle multiple responsibilities, including front desk operations, check-ins, guest services, and administrative tasks. So responding to inbound questions during peak hours is nearly impossible. 

This is where AI automation becomes a game-changer. Instead of losing potential bookings to slow response times, hotels can use WhatsApp AI to provide instant, accurate responses 24/7, ensuring no inquiry goes unanswered.

How WhatsApp AI transforms hotel operations

Instant availability and pricing responses

WhatsApp AI chatbots can integrate directly with your property management system to provide real-time room availability and pricing information. When a guest asks about weekend rates, the AI instantly accesses your PMS, checks availability, and provides accurate pricing without any human intervention.

Multi-language support without language barriers

International guests often hesitate to contact hotels due to language concerns. Visito’s WhatsApp AI eliminates this barrier by providing instant translation and responses in over 100 languages. A German tourist can ask in German and receive fluent responses, while a Spanish-speaking family gets assistance in their preferred language.

This multilingual capability opens entirely new market segments for hotels without requiring multilingual staff or expensive translation services.

Reduced booking fees

Each direct booking through WhatsApp AI saves hotels the 15-30% commission fees charged by online travel agencies, like Booking.com or Expedia. For a 50-room property, this can translate to $50,000-100,000 in annual savings depending on average daily rates and booking volume.

Implementation best practices for hotels

Start with your most common questions

Begin by identifying the questions your staff answers repeatedly, such as room availability, amenities, location directions, and booking policies. These become your AI's initial focus areas, providing immediate value while you expand its capabilities.

Maintain the human touch

The most successful WhatsApp AI implementations blend automation with human expertise. Use AI for information gathering, availability checks, and routine bookings, but ensure complex requests and special circumstances get transferred to experienced staff members. A smooth AI agent to human agent hand-off is critical so that guests feel cared for.

Integrate with existing systems

Your WhatsApp AI should connect seamlessly with your hotel booking engine, property management software (PMS), or channel manager. Cloudbeds and SiteMinder are two examples of a PMS and channel manager for hotels. This integration ensures guests can see real-time rates and receive accurate, up-to-date information while preventing overbooking or pricing errors.

Train staff on AI collaboration

Your team needs to understand how to work alongside AI rather than compete with it. Train staff to handle escalated conversations, review AI interactions for improvement opportunities, and use freed-up time for higher-value guest service activities.
